Abstract
The article focuses on a study investigating effectiveness of laser peripheral iridoplasty (LPI) in the treatment of corneal endothelium. It mentions that LPI on eye was analyzed in patients and no visible photothermal effects were found on the cornea with diode laser in any of the patients. It states that the Diode LPI treatment is safe with regard to corneal endothelial effects.
